Mill Flat Campground is pretty arid typically; February is the wettest month with most snow, and June is when it's the driest. Summertime highs at Mill Flat Campground mostly tend to be in the 80's. When the night sets in temperatures fall down into the 40's. For the period of the wintertime highs are ordinarily in the 30's, and after the sun is down throughout the wintertime temperatures at Mill Flat Campground |
